Leave of Absence
As a pilot for UAV, it is your responsibility to abide by all of the airline regulations and requirements. One of these is to file TWO pireps every month. If you will be unable to execute this task, then you may file for a leave of absence. A leave of absence is a period in which you are requesting your account to be put on hold due to not being able to perform the required activity. Your leave of absence may not exceed 90 days and we require a specific reason for your leave of absence. To avoid abuse, pilots may not file for more than 3 leave of absences per year.

Pilot Ranking/Seniority
Second Officer (0 Flights) First Officer (5 Flights) Captain (20 Flights) Veteran (50 Flights) Most active pilot (Most flights in Hub) Top Pilot (Most active pilot in Airline) ATP Instructor (Pilot Trainer) (Must have at least 50 flights and pass exam)

Teamspeak 3 Server

United Airlines Virtual has a fully operational TS3 server. Teamspeak 3 is the most advanced VOIP (Voice over IP) software available. We use our server for multiplayer communications, pilot and staff communications and just for a social room of course. In the multiplayer session, we do not use FSX voice, but TS3 voice to decrease session lag, and to provide better voice communications. Below I list how to install TS3 on your PC.

How to Install Teamspeak 3 on a PC


Go to www.teamspeak.com and go to the downloads tab, and click Teamspeak3 Select the download for the 32 or 64- Bit client Follow the installation wizard included in the download Configure your client to use a push to talk key for transmitting

Note: When you are accepted into the airlines, we will issue you the server address and password to connect to our server as well as the nickname to use.
